Halton Student Transportation Services (HSTS) is helping young students start the school year with confidence by once again offering its First-Time Rider Program later this month.
Designed especially for primary students from Junior Kindergarten to Grade 3, this fun and educational program introduces kids to school buses and bus safety in a relaxed setting before the first day of school.
The one-hour session includes:
- A short school bus ride
- Safety handouts to take home
- A viewing of “Buzzy the Bee’s Safety Video”, which teaches key safety tips in a fun, engaging way
HSTS encourages all families with young riders to participate in this important back-to-school tradition. It’s a great way to ease first-day nerves and help children (and parents!) feel comfortable and ready for the ride ahead.
It’s happening on Saturday, August 23rd.
